If Cowboys wants to come out with a win vs Kansas City Chiefs then they must neutralize DT: Chris Jones & TE: Travis Kelce.

Chris Jones is a monster in the middle who can rush and collapse the pocket from inside, or if stalled at LOS then he bats down passes with his length. In the run game he is stout who can hold LOS & penetrate for tackle for loss.

In passing plays the OL needs to combo block him with guard-center if he is lined up inside and tackle-guard if he is on the edge. I’ll leave him 1v1 vs Martin or Collins. Dak needs have a deeper drop and roll out to avoid passes being batted down.


On defense Kelce must doubled with one player playing press man and other covering the top. If playing zone still press him at LOS and funnel him to the help side at all times.

Spy Mahomes with Micah Parsons.

The big plays are what Dallas needs to stop. Hill needs to be priority 1. Kelce in the middle of the field is 2. If Mahomes is forced to dink and dunk he'll eventually get impatient and force a couple shots and that is where Dallas can turn the game.



Kc has no running game and after Hill they have JAG wideouts.
